Course details

Unit 1: Introduction to Enterprise Mentoring – Understanding the fundamentals of enterprise mentoring, its importance in business management, and the role of a mentor.
Unit 2: Mentoring Models – Exploring various mentoring models, including one-on-one, group, and peer mentoring, and their applications in business environments.
Unit 3: Professional Communication for Mentors – Mastering effective communication strategies, active listening, and feedback techniques to foster a productive mentor-mentee relationship.
Unit 4: Undergraduate Diploma in Enterprise Mentoring – Delving into the specifics of the diploma program, its curriculum, and benefits for aspiring business managers.
Unit 5: Mentoring Best Practices – Learning evidence-based best practices in enterprise mentoring, ethical considerations, and cultural sensitivity.
Unit 6: Developing a Mentoring Program – Designing, implementing, and evaluating a comprehensive enterprise mentoring program for businesses.
Unit 7: Mentoring in the Digital Age – Adapting mentoring strategies to virtual and remote environments, leveraging technology for effective mentoring.
Unit 8: Case Studies in Enterprise Mentoring – Analyzing real-world examples of successful enterprise mentoring initiatives and their impact on business performance.
Unit 9: Mentoring for Diversity and Inclusion – Fostering an inclusive mentoring environment that supports underrepresented groups in business management.
Unit 10: Transitioning from Mentoring to Business Management – Applying mentoring skills to leadership roles, setting goals, and developing a career path in business management.
